Kidney Disease

Your Content Goes Here Chronic kidney disease (CKD) is a serious condition where the kidneys sustain long-term damage or experience reduced function lasting three months or more. Without proper treatment, CKD can progress to full kidney failure, at which point dialysis or a kidney transplant becomes the only way to survive.

ID Program

Your Content Goes Here The Kidney Foundation is now offering free MyID bracelets, wallet cards, and portable ID tags to all dialysis patients in our 20-county service area.
